Dictionary Results for marketing
1. marketing - noun · the exchange of goods for an agreed sum of money Synonym(s): selling, merchandising Hypernym(s): commerce, commercialism, mercantilism
2. marketing - noun · the commercial processes involved in promoting and selling and distributing a product or service; "most companies have a manager in charge of marketing" Hypernym(s): commerce, commercialism, mercantilism
3. marketing - noun · shopping at a market; "does the weekly marketing at the supermarket" Hypernym(s): shopping
4. market - verb · engage in the commercial promotion, sale, or distribution of; "The company is marketing its new line of beauty products" Hypernym(s): trade, merchandise
5. market - verb · buy household supplies; "We go marketing every Saturday" Hypernym(s): shop
6. market - verb · deal in a market Hypernym(s): deal, sell, trade
7. market - verb · make commercial; "Some Amish people have commercialized their way of life" Synonym(s): commercialize, commercialise Hypernym(s): change, alter, modify
